Adekunle Gold Gets Hosted By BBC World Service And He Is On Top Of The World

Nigerian singer, Adekunle Gold was a guest at the BBC World Service Centre in London where he got hosted on their radio station, their Facebook live feed, and the popular ‘Focus on Africa’ show. 


The singer is in the country ahead of his coming ‘One Night Stand’ concert on the 30th which has already been sold out.

Adekunle Gold described his genre of music as urban highlife.

His 2014 single, “Sade”,  received massive airplay on various Nigerian radio stations.

His follow-up single, titled “Orente”, also received positive reviews from music critics and consumers.

 In 2015, he was nominated in the Most Promising Act of the Year category at the 2015 City People Entertainment Awards.

The award winning singer's 2014 single, “Sade”, was nominated for Best Alternative Song at The Headies 2015.

In 2015, he was signed to YBNL Nation under which he released his debut studio album Gold.
